Lighting Engineering Software |
|
Fael-Lite is an application which has been developed for determining illumination and luminance values in internal, external and street contexts. It is a 32-bit programme which runs on the WINDOWS platform and can operate in 2D or 3D environments of all shapes and sizes including circular areas and locations.
The extremely attractive format alongside the implementation of the standard WINDOWS menu system makes this application a very useful tool for planners, installers, and end-users.
The programme is capable of determining horizontal and vertical illuminations, vertical illuminations in the direction of the camera, semicylindricals, luminance, and glare indexes, all in line with the most recent UNI (Italian Standards Institute) and CEI recommendations.
For internal environments, the application can determine and automatically position lamps according to the level of illumination desired and with consideration for reflections between walls, the floor and the ceiling to the seventh level.

The results can be previewed in a graphical format as isolux Photometric datas and threedimensional isolux.
Functionality is provided forthe management of tower racks for external projectors by means of which it is possible to duplicate the equipment according to axes of symmetry which can be determined.
The programme interfaces with the external catalogue from which it is possible to obtain technical information on the lamps such as: design features, photographs, descriptions, information, photometric Photometric datas.
At the printing stage, it is possible to choose a different language from that used during the planning stage.
HARDWARE-SOFTWARE CONFIGURATION
Computer: Pentium 3 or higher
RAM Memory: 128 Mb
Disk Drive: multi-session 32 X speed CD ROM
Hard Disk: with at least 30 Mb free for the program and project files
Video: resolution 1024x768 pixel
Operating System : Windows® 98*,Windows 2000*,Windows XP*
